Saya mengerti ide antarmuka baris perintah mungkin sedikit tidak nyaman pada awalnya, tetapi sebenarnya itu adalah pilihan yang masuk akal. Anda menggunakan antarmuka baris perintah seperti pada Desktop sehingga Anda seharusnya sudah terbiasa dengan bash / zsh / shell pilihan.
Keuntungan - cepat dan aman (via ssh).
Lingkungan desktop IMO tidak benar-benar membantu pada server karena semua sisi server adalah baris perintah.
Mulai / hentikan layanan, edit file konfigurasi, instal / perbarui paket, pindahkan file data, firewall dan alat jaringan, dan manajemen pengguna tugas seperti itu tidak ditingkatkan dengan menjalankan terminal grafis.
Menginstal lingkungan desktop menambahkan ratusan paket yang sebagian besar tidak digunakan dan dengan demikian menghabiskan ruang disk, upgrade yang rumit, dan menambah lubang keamanan potensial (lebih banyak aplikasi == lebih banyak celah keamanan potensial).
chrylis Sungguh, belajar CLI. Ini adalah dasar untuk alat manajemen yang andal seperti Puppet atau Terraform karena dapat otomatis.
el.pescado Saya juga merekomendasikan membiasakan diri dengan alat commandline. Beberapa distribusi menyediakan alat admin GUI (seperti YAST di OpenSuse), tetapi setiap distribusi tersebut menyediakan yang berbeda. Alat baris perintah, di sisi lain, bekerja kurang lebih sama di setiap Linux.
Alat grafis - solusi WEB
Jika Anda merasa PERLU antarmuka grafis, gunakan salah satu dari banyak antarmuka berbasis web. Alat-alat ini lebih cepat dari VNC, lebih aman daripada VNC, antarmuka grafis, dan tugas server khusus.
Anda dapat mengamankannya melalui https atau ssh (tergantung alat).
Anda dapat menghubungkan mereka dari OS apa pun melalui browser.
Selain manajemen server ada beberapa alat yang tersedia untuk mengatur server Anda.
NIDS (Network Intrusion Detection)
Snort https://www.snort.org/ hanyalah satu alat untuk memonitor lalu lintas jaringan, mungkin sedikit berlebihan bagi sebagian besar pengguna. Base adalah antarmuka grafis untuk mendengus:
Jawaban:
Baris perintah sudah cukup
Saya mengerti ide antarmuka baris perintah mungkin sedikit tidak nyaman pada awalnya, tetapi sebenarnya itu adalah pilihan yang masuk akal. Anda menggunakan antarmuka baris perintah seperti pada Desktop sehingga Anda seharusnya sudah terbiasa dengan bash / zsh / shell pilihan.
Keuntungan - cepat dan aman (via ssh).
Lingkungan desktop IMO tidak benar-benar membantu pada server karena semua sisi server adalah baris perintah.
Mulai / hentikan layanan, edit file konfigurasi, instal / perbarui paket, pindahkan file data, firewall dan alat jaringan, dan manajemen pengguna tugas seperti itu tidak ditingkatkan dengan menjalankan terminal grafis.
Menginstal lingkungan desktop menambahkan ratusan paket yang sebagian besar tidak digunakan dan dengan demikian menghabiskan ruang disk, upgrade yang rumit, dan menambah lubang keamanan potensial (lebih banyak aplikasi == lebih banyak celah keamanan potensial).
Untuk mengelola server gunakan layar ssh + atau layar alternatif - Apakah ada alternatif lain yang ramah pengguna?
Ini memungkinkan Anda untuk melampirkan dan memasang kembali ke server Anda.
Pastikan untuk mengamankan ssh dengan kunci paling tidak http://bodhizazen.com/Tutorials/SSH_security
nano / vim / emacs adalah alat yang hebat untuk mengedit. Anda dapat menggunakan vim + ssh mengedit file dari jarak jauh /unix/202918/how-do-i-remotely-edit-files-via-ssh
Atau Anda dapat memasang sistem file Anda melalui sshfs https://help.ubuntu.com/community/SSHFS
Dari komentar
chrylis Sungguh, belajar CLI. Ini adalah dasar untuk alat manajemen yang andal seperti Puppet atau Terraform karena dapat otomatis.
el.pescado Saya juga merekomendasikan membiasakan diri dengan alat commandline. Beberapa distribusi menyediakan alat admin GUI (seperti YAST di OpenSuse), tetapi setiap distribusi tersebut menyediakan yang berbeda. Alat baris perintah, di sisi lain, bekerja kurang lebih sama di setiap Linux.
Alat grafis - solusi WEB
Jika Anda merasa PERLU antarmuka grafis, gunakan salah satu dari banyak antarmuka berbasis web. Alat-alat ini lebih cepat dari VNC, lebih aman daripada VNC, antarmuka grafis, dan tugas server khusus.
Anda dapat mengamankannya melalui https atau ssh (tergantung alat).
Anda dapat menghubungkan mereka dari OS apa pun melalui browser.
Dan jika diperlukan ada beberapa antarmuka web khusus seperti
Vitrualisasi juga memiliki beberapa opsi.
Manajer Virt - mendukung KVM, Xen, dan LXC dengan bumbu dan penampil VNC bawaan .
Jika Anda menggunakan KVM, Anda dapat menggunakan Virt Manager melalui ssh - https://access.redhat.com/documentation/en-US/Red_Hat_Enterprise_Linux/6/html/Virtualization_Guide/chap-Virtualization_Administration_Guide-Remote_manual_vi_
Ada berbagai alat alternatif yang dapat Anda temukan banyak antarmuka web jika Anda mencari di Google. https://www.tecmint.com/web-control-panels-to-manage-linux-servers/
Solusi berbayar seperti cpanel sangat populer.
Cpanel https://cpanel.com/ https://cpanel.com/
Alat keamanan
Selain manajemen server ada beberapa alat yang tersedia untuk mengatur server Anda.
Snort https://www.snort.org/ hanyalah satu alat untuk memonitor lalu lintas jaringan, mungkin sedikit berlebihan bagi sebagian besar pengguna. Base adalah antarmuka grafis untuk mendengus:
Lihat https://s3.amazonaws.com/snort-org-site/production/document_files/files/000/000/122/original/Snort_2.9.9.x_on_Ubuntu_14-16.pdf
https://ubuntuforums.org/showthread.php?t=1477696
HIDS (Host Intrusion Detection System)
OSSEC populer - https://ossec.github.io/
Nagios - https://www.nagios.org/ lagi opsi yang sangat populer
sumber